Output 340047701ca94be94dd8c3dbc7d5c6a605985f68da00ffc21ba88034369941d5:0

value
2060771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58addcf5e6e175f63d39d7723d0314c975ee656 OP_EQUAL
address
3KhXPwiJJF6FBXQq7AbxjtZ3FPymvvv2pF
transaction
340047701ca94be94dd8c3dbc7d5c6a605985f68da00ffc21ba88034369941d5
spent
true